RV Air Purifier Filter Technologies Explained

Understanding the different filter technologies employed in RV air purifiers is crucial for making an informed purchasing decision. The cornerstone of most effective air purifiers is the HEPA (High-Efficiency Particulate Air) filter. True HEPA filters are certified to capture at least 99.97% of airborne particles, including dust, pollen, mold spores, bacteria, and viruses, down to 0.3 microns in size. This makes them indispensable for allergy sufferers and for creating a healthier indoor environment. However, it’s important to note that HEPA filters themselves do not remove odors or gases; they primarily target particulate matter.

To address odors and gaseous pollutants, activated carbon filters are essential. These filters are made from porous carbon material that has been treated to be highly absorbent. Activated carbon excels at adsorbing volatile organic compounds (VOCs) emitted from sources like cleaning products, furniture off-gassing, and cooking fumes, as well as smoke and pet odors. The effectiveness of an activated carbon filter is largely dependent on the amount of carbon used and its surface area; a thicker, more dense carbon filter will generally provide superior odor removal capabilities.

A crucial component for any air purifier intended for general use is the pre-filter. This is typically a washable or disposable mesh layer positioned at the front of the filtration system. Its primary function is to capture larger airborne particles such as pet hair, lint, and visible dust. By trapping these larger contaminants, the pre-filter significantly extends the lifespan of the more delicate HEPA and activated carbon filters, preventing them from becoming clogged prematurely and ensuring their optimal performance.

Beyond these core technologies, some air purifiers incorporate advanced features like UV-C light sterilization or negative ionizers. UV-C light is a germicidal wavelength of ultraviolet light that can kill or inactivate bacteria, viruses, and mold spores. Negative ionizers release negatively charged ions into the air, which attach to airborne particles, causing them to clump together and become heavier, thus falling to the ground or being more easily captured by the purifier’s filters. However, it is vital to be aware that some ionization technologies can produce ozone as a byproduct, which can be irritating to the respiratory system, especially in confined spaces like an RV. Therefore, when considering these advanced technologies, prioritizing ozone-free certifications or units with adjustable ionizer output is highly recommended.

Maintaining Your RV Air Purifier for Peak Performance

Proper maintenance is not merely a suggestion but a critical requirement for ensuring your RV air purifier consistently delivers clean air and operates at its peak performance throughout your travels. The most fundamental aspect of maintenance revolves around the regular cleaning and replacement of filters. The pre-filter, often a washable mesh, should be cleaned frequently, ideally every few weeks, depending on the air quality in your RV and the usage of the unit. A simple vacuuming or gentle rinsing under cool water, followed by thorough drying, can significantly prolong its life and maintain its effectiveness in capturing larger particles.

The HEPA and activated carbon filters, which are typically not washable, have a finite lifespan and will eventually become saturated and lose their efficacy. The recommended replacement schedule for these filters can vary significantly based on the manufacturer, the specific model, and the environmental conditions in which the RV is used. However, as a general guideline, HEPA filters often need replacement every 6 to 12 months, while activated carbon filters may require replacement every 3 to 6 months. Neglecting to replace these filters will not only reduce the purifier’s ability to remove pollutants and odors but can also create a breeding ground for trapped microorganisms, potentially reintroducing them into the air.

Beyond filter management, it’s essential to maintain the exterior and interior components of the air purifier. Periodically, gently wipe down the exterior casing with a soft, damp cloth to remove dust and grime. Pay close attention to the air intake and outlet vents to ensure they are free of obstructions that could impede airflow. Some units may have accessible internal components that can be carefully cleaned with a soft brush or vacuum attachment to remove accumulated dust. Always ensure the unit is unplugged before attempting any cleaning of internal parts to prevent electrical hazards.

Finally, always store replacement filters in a clean, dry place, protected from dust and moisture, to preserve their integrity. Refer to your air purifier’s owner’s manual for specific cleaning and maintenance instructions tailored to your model. Following these guidelines diligently will not only extend the operational life of your RV air purifier but also guarantee that it continues to provide a healthier and more comfortable breathing environment within your mobile living space, trip after trip.

The Impact of Air Quality on RV Living and Travel

The confined and often recirculated air within an RV can significantly impact the health and comfort of its occupants, making air quality a crucial aspect of the RV lifestyle. Unlike static homes with consistent ventilation, RVs are inherently mobile environments, exposed to a diverse range of external air pollutants during transit and at various destinations. Driving on highways can introduce exhaust fumes, diesel particulates, and road dust into the vehicle, even with windows closed, if seals are not perfect. Moreover, the materials used in RV construction, such as adhesives, plastics, and treated wood, can off-gas Volatile Organic Compounds (VOCs) over time, contributing to indoor air pollution.

Furthermore, the activities undertaken within an RV can further degrade air quality. Cooking, particularly frying or using gas stoves without adequate ventilation, can release particulate matter, carbon monoxide, and nitrogen dioxide. The presence of pets, while often a beloved part of the RV experience, invariably contributes to airborne allergens like dander and associated odors. In humid climates or during periods of poor ventilation, mold and mildew can develop, releasing spores that are detrimental to respiratory health and can trigger allergic reactions. Even the accumulation of everyday dust can become a significant irritant in a small, enclosed space.

The consequences of poor air quality in an RV can range from mild discomfort to more serious health issues. Symptoms like headaches, fatigue, dizziness, eye and throat irritation, and respiratory problems such as coughing and wheezing are common indicators of subpar indoor air. For individuals with pre-existing respiratory conditions like asthma or allergies, poor air quality can exacerbate their symptoms, making their travel experience unpleasant and potentially hazardous. The constant exposure to allergens and irritants can also contribute to the development of new sensitivities over time.

Consequently, maintaining good air quality is not just about creating a pleasant ambiance; it’s about safeguarding the well-being of everyone inside the RV. 3. Coverage Area and CADR: Matching Power to Your Space

Determining the appropriate coverage area and Clean Air Delivery Rate (CADR) is critical for ensuring an air purifier can effectively clean the air within your RV. RVs, while often spacious, are still relatively confined compared to a typical house. You need a unit that can process the air volume efficiently without being excessively oversized or underpowered. The CADR rating, provided by manufacturers, indicates how quickly a purifier can remove specific pollutants – typically smoke, dust, and pollen – from a room. Higher CADR ratings translate to faster and more effective air cleaning.

For most RVs, a unit with a CADR suitable for rooms ranging from 100 to 250 square feet is generally sufficient. However, it’s prudent to consider the total usable living space when making your decision. If you have a larger Class A motorhome, you might require a slightly more powerful unit than someone with a compact travel trailer. Moreover, consider the air exchange rate. Ideally, an air purifier should be able to exchange the air in a room at least 4-5 times per hour to effectively remove contaminants. While RV manufacturers don’t typically provide room dimensions for air purifiers in the same way residential ones do, it’s useful to measure the primary living and sleeping areas. Selecting a purifier with a CADR that significantly exceeds the actual square footage of your RV can provide a buffer, ensuring rapid and thorough air cleaning, thus positioning it among the best air purifiers for RVs for comprehensive air quality management.

How does a HEPA filter work, and why is it important for RV air purifiers?

A High-Efficiency Particulate Air (HEPA) filter is a mechanical air filter that works by forcing air through a fine mesh that traps 99.97% of particles 0.3 microns in size. This size is critical because it represents the most penetrating particle size, meaning that if a filter can trap particles of this size effectively, it will also trap a higher percentage of both larger and smaller particles. In an RV, this translates to the capture of microscopic allergens like dust mites, pollen, pet dander, and mold spores, which are common triggers for respiratory distress.

The importance of HEPA filtration in RVs stems from the reduced air volume and the close proximity of occupants to potential contaminants. Unlike a home with higher ceilings and better ventilation, an RV’s confined space means that inhaled particles are more concentrated. By employing a HEPA filter, the air purifier significantly reduces the burden of these allergens and irritants on occupants’ respiratory systems, contributing to improved sleep quality and overall well-being during travel.

What is the difference between a HEPA filter and an activated carbon filter in an RV air purifier?

A HEPA filter is designed to physically trap airborne particulate matter. Its dense fiber structure acts as a physical barrier, capturing microscopic particles like dust, pollen, pet dander, mold spores, and even some bacteria and viruses. The effectiveness of a HEPA filter is quantified by its ability to remove particles of a specific size (0.3 microns), and its efficiency rate (typically 99.97% or higher). This makes it essential for addressing allergens and other solid contaminants that can trigger respiratory issues.

An activated carbon filter, on the other hand, targets gaseous pollutants and odors through a process called adsorption. Activated carbon is a highly porous material with a massive surface area, which attracts and binds gas molecules to its surface. This includes volatile organic compounds (VOCs) released from RV materials, cooking fumes, smoke, and unpleasant smells from pets or dampness. Therefore, a comprehensive air purifier for an RV ideally incorporates both HEPA and activated carbon filtration to address both particulate and gaseous contaminants effectively.

How can I determine the appropriate size (CADR) for an RV air purifier?

The Clean Air Delivery Rate (CADR) is a crucial metric that measures how quickly an air purifier can clean the air in a given space. It is typically rated for specific room sizes. For RVs, the concept translates to matching the purifier’s CADR to the volume of your RV’s interior. You can estimate your RV’s interior volume by measuring its length, width, and height and multiplying these dimensions to get cubic feet.

Once you have your RV’s cubic footage, you can consult the manufacturer’s specifications for the CADR. A general guideline is to choose an air purifier with a CADR that can achieve at least 4-5 air changes per hour (ACH) for the estimated volume of your RV. This means the purifier should be able to circulate and clean the entire volume of air in your RV at least four to five times every hour, ensuring effective removal of contaminants in the confined space.
